How can aggressive driving behaviors be avoided?

Adopting a calm demeanor while driving significantly reduces the likelihood of aggressive driving behaviors. By staying calm, a driver creates a more relaxed driving environment, which helps in making better decisions, reacting appropriately to road conditions, and demonstrating patience in traffic situations. It allows for a more mindful approach to driving, leading to safer interactions with other road users.

Additionally, allowing sufficient time to reach your destination helps in reducing stress that can often trigger aggressive tendencies. When drivers feel rushed, they may resort to risky behaviors such as speeding or making unsafe maneuvers, which contribute to aggressive driving. By planning ahead and giving oneself enough time, one can avoid these pressures and maintain a safe and composed driving style.
